Analysis Of Different Types Of Attentional Interference Compared To Working Memory, Joel A. Gregor
Analysis Of Different Types Of Attentional Interference Compared To Working Memory, Joel A. Gregor
Doctor of Psychology (PsyD)
Previous studies have shown a relationship between working memory (WM) and the Color-Word Stroop Task (CWS). Newer Stroop-like tasks such as the Color-Block Stroop-like Task (CBS) have been shown to cause interference but the nature of the interference is unclear. This study attempted to compare CWS and CBS to tests of working memory, specifically the Digits Span Backward task (DB) and an Operation Span (OSPAN) task. The first experiment involved no auditory stimuli. No significant correlation was found between WM and CWS. This led to a second experiment with the digit span administered auditorily.
